The 737-700s began joining the fleet in 1997. The variant flew for 15 years with a capacity of 137 seats. In 2012, Southwest introduced new, slimmer seats, which allowed room for six more seats. Now, the plane accommodates 143 seats. Southwest operated the -300, -500, and -700 jointly until the Classic series variants were retired entirely in 2016.The average age of the planes in the Southwest fleet is about 9 years. Each plane flies an average of seven, 607 mile flights per day, amounting to about 12.5 hours of flying time. Southwest was the launch customer for the Boeing 737-700 in 1997. If you want to maximize your legroom on a Delta flight, you'll need to go beyond the basic fare—but you won't need to leave the main cabin.Sep 6, 2023 · Southwest flies several versions of the Boeing 737, including the 737-700, 737-800 and 737 MAX 8. The 737-700 has 143 seats in 24 rows, while both the 737-800 and 737 MAX 8 have 175 seats in 30 rows. Starting in 2025, Southwest will take delivery of new Boeing 737-800 and 737 MAX-8 airplanes, both of which will showcase the brand-new seat design. We need to remember that permitting airlines to merge allows these companies to operate as monopolies, so they really do not care about serving the customer., N522SW, N526SW, and N527SW ended an era on September 6th, 2016. The company first took on the 737-700 in December 1997 when N700GS arrived. This model by far makes up the biggest segment of 737 aircraft in Southwest's fleet. The airline currently has 472 of them across its facilities. Moreover, 42 units were previously operated by the firm., Southwest Airline's website records that the airline owned five Boeing 727 in its lifetime. The first arrived in 1978 and the last in 1984. The aircraft was operated until 1985, meaning the aircraft belonged to the Southwest fleet for seven years. When passengers board, they can choose any available seat remaining., Standard seat pitch (the measure of legroom space between a point on one seat and the same point on the seat in front of it) 38" (96 cm) 34" – 38" (86.4 cm – 96.5 cm) 30" (76.2 cm) Standard seat recline (the distance between a seat back in its full upright and full recline position) 5" (12.7 cm) 3" (7.6 cm) 2" (5 cm) Seat width, Sep 25, 2019 · Back in 1971, Southwest Airlines started with its very first Boeing 737. It was a 737-200, of which the airline eventually ended up having 64 over a period between 1971 and 2005. The airline first came to consider the 737-200 when its idol Pacific Southwest Airlines took a look at the aircraft for its fleet. , The company is headquartered in Dallas, USA.
